Scientific name: Sepia Pharaonis; cuttlefish species that can be found west of the Indian Ocean between the Red Sea area and the Persian Gulf. It can reach up to 42 cm in lenght and 5 kg in weight.
Origin: India.
Fishing zone: FAO zone 51. It is located in the Indian Ocean and extends froms the east coast of India to the east coast of Africa, reaching the meridian 45 south. This area in turn is divided into eight sub-zones.
